Excel 2007: Business Statistics with Cortés Farey shows managers and executives how to assess their organization's data effectively by applying statistical analysis techniques. The course covers important statistical terms and definitions, and then dives into techniques using the tools in Excel: formulas and functions for calculating averages and standard deviations, charts and graphs for summarizing data, and the Analysis Toolpak add-in for even greater insights into data. Exercise files are included with the course.

Topics include:
• Understanding statistical terms
• Creating a basic Excel table
• Auditing formulas
• Creating frequency distributions for qualitative data
• Calculating a running total
• Creating a histogram
• Using PivotTables
• Calculating mean, median, mode, and other numerical data
• Using probability distributions
• Population sampling
• Testing hypotheses
• Developing liner and multiple regression models

The skills acquired from this version are mostly applicable to newer versions of Excel.
